CAT exam syllabus 2022

Topics from three subjects are included in the CAT Syllabus: Verbal Ability and Reading Comprehension (VARC), Quantitative Aptitude (QA), and Data Interpretation and Logical Reasoning (DILR).

  • Grammar, vocabulary, RC passages, and para jumbles are all covered in the CAT VARC Syllabus.
  • DI sets based on tables, graphs & charts, and LR problems based on analytical & non-verbal reasoning make up the CAT DILR Syllabus.
  • The CAT Quant Syllabus covers topics in mathematics from grades 10 to 12, including arithmetic, algebra, numbers, geometry, and more.

Preparation Strategy, Study Plan, and Topper Tips for CAT 2022

To begin preparing for the CAT 2022 exam, one should solve and analyze the previous year's question papers, go over the full subject-by-subject exam analysis, and aim to master at least 70% of the syllabus in 2-3 months.

The first question that most aspirants have is How to Prepare for the CAT exam. As a result, applicants should review the section-by-section CAT 2022 preparation tips and methods listed below.

Data Interpretation and Logical Reasoning CAT Preparation (DILR).

In the DILR portion, questions are asked in sets of 4-5 questions, and correctly answering one set will earn you 12-15 marks.

  • Solve at least 5-6 DI tasks every week for CAT DI preparation using a variety of data sets, including bar graphs, line graphs, pie charts, tabular data.
  • Begin by answering questions with only 5 variables, then progress to questions with 7-8 variables.
  • Be comprehensive with crucial ratio-percentage conversions, profit & loss, averages, and other arithmetic concepts to manage time while solving DI problems.
  • Practice is essential for CAT LR preparation. Every day, try to answer as many questions as possible. For one day, choose one LR topic and answer 20-30 questions of varying difficulty.

Quantitative CAT Preparation (QA)

In the CAT Quant part, arithmetic accounts for half of the problems. Numbers and Modern Mathematics receive the least amount of questions (about 2-3). Concentrate your efforts on Arithmetic, Algebra, and Geometry.

  • Understand the fundamentals of calculation, including ratio-percentage conversion, squares, and cubes up to 30, square roots and cube roots, averages, exponential theorems, divisibility laws, the idea of numbers, units digit, probability, P&C, and tables up to 25.
  • Concentrate your efforts in Arithmetic on concepts such as profit and loss, TSD, time and work, mixtures, averages, and percentages.
  • Triangles, Circles, and Parallelograms are the most essential topics in Geometry. Learn all of the important triangle and circle theorems and formulas. Both 2D and 3D - will also ask one question.
  • Sectional mock tests must be completed within the time constraint of 40 minutes. After each mock test, evaluate your performance and correct any faults.

CAT Verbal Ability and Reading Comprehension Preparation (VARC)

In CAT VARC, RC accounts for more than half of the questions asked. Para jumbles, odd one out, para summary, and error detection are all essential topics in Verbal Ability.

  • To increase vocabulary, read newspapers, magazines, or online articles on a daily basis. Even while solving RC passages, note down the new words that you encounter.
  • To brush up on your grammar concepts and to practice questions on error detection, para jumbles, para summary, fill in the blanks and refer to the best books for CAT preparation.
  • To increase your reading speed for RC passages, start with short passages (250-350 words) and then gradually move to 500+ word passages.
  • Solve CAT previous year question papers, sample papers, and various online mock test series to get a hold of a variety of questions.

Mock Tests and Question Papers for the CAT

Previous year's CAT question papers can assist you to comprehend the kind of questions and the paper's difficulty level. Additionally, solving 1-2 question sheets on a regular basis will aid in improving your speed and accuracy when answering questions. 

  • A few weeks before the CAT exam date, the CAT 2022 Mock Test will be available on the official website.
  • The CAT 2022 Mock test will be 120 minutes in total, with a 40-minute sectional time limit. iimcat.ac.in will provide official links to take the practice tests.
  • Aspirants will have access to online examinations through the CAT 2022 Mock Test Link to familiarize themselves with computer-based test instructions, procedures, and features.

Form Correction (CAT 2022).

After the registration window closes, the CAT 2022 Form Correction window will be open for a few days. Candidates that pay their application fee within the deadline will be able to amend the following information:

  • Signature
  • Photograph
  • Test City Preferences

Exam Pattern for CAT 2022.

IIM updated the CAT exam pattern in 2021, and these modifications are expected to persist for the CAT 2022 exam. As a result, according to the CAT Exam Pattern 2022, the CAT exam papers will be divided into three portions, each with 66 questions.

  • Exam Mode: The CAT 2022 exam will be held in an online CBT format at 438+ test centers throughout 158+ major cities in India.
  • CAT Exam Medium: The CAT Exam is exclusively offered in English.
  • Duration of the CAT Exam: 120 minutes for the complete CAT exam paper.
  • Sectional Each of the three portions has a time limit of 40 minutes.
  • MCQs and TITA-style questions are the most common types of questions.
  • There are a total of 66 questions in this quiz. (70-75 percent multiple-choice questions, 25-30 percent TITA-style questions)
  • The test is divided into three sections: Verbal Ability and Reading Comprehension (VARC), Quantitative Aptitude (QA), and Data Interpretation and Logical Reasoning (DIR) (DILR).
  • The CAT Marking Scheme is as follows: For each accurate response, 3 points are awarded, while for each incorrect answer, 1 point is subtracted. For TITA-style questions, there is no negative grading.
